Portland, Ore. - - Oregon Tech’s Hannah Brewster, a 5-6 sophomore from Medford, Ore., was named the Cascade Conference Libero of the Week. Brewster totaled 94 digs in six matches as the Owls posted a 4-2 record to improve to 6-4 on the season. Honorable mention: Whitney Owen, College of Idaho; Dana Clark, Northwest Christian.

Other winners for CCC Players of the week-

Setter -Northwest Christian’s Cori Wallace, a 5-7 freshman from Klamath Falls, Ore., was named the CCC’s Setter of the Week after posting 90 assists in four matches at the Lewis-Clark State Tournament in Lewiston. Wallace had a season-high 31 assists in the Beacons’ 3-1 non-conference victory over Warner Pacific. Wallace also had 46 digs in the tournament. Honorable mention: Naomi Reimer, College of Idaho; Sarah Svedin, Oregon Tech.

Hitter -College of Idaho’s Sarah Harris, a 5-10 senior from MIddleton, Idaho, was named the CCC’s Hitter of the Week. In five matches, Harris averaged 4.17 kills and posted a .353 hitting percentage on her way to earning all-tournament honors at the Tournament of Champions in Salt Lake City. Harris also had 15 assisted blocks, four solo blocks, and 14 digs for the 16th-ranked Yotes. Honorable mention: Cassie Bishop, Northwest Christian; Megan Christensen, Oregon Tech.
